Title: Oliver Wasenmueller: Innovator in Surveillance Technology.

Introduction: Oliver Wasenmueller is a notable inventor based in Kaiserslautern, Germany. He has made significant contributions to the field of surveillance technology, with one patented invention focusing on monitoring areas effectively and efficiently.

Latest Patents: Oliver’s patent, titled "Camera for monitoring a monitored area and monitoring device, and method for monitoring a monitored area," showcases his ingenuity. This innovative camera encompasses a camera sensor that generates unmasked surveillance images of the monitored area and includes an integrated evaluation unit. The evaluation unit is equipped with an input interface for receiving raw data and an output interface that provides processed image data, enhancing the monitoring capabilities of the device.
